Today’s highlights…

The potential transfer that could bring Pablo Armero to Juventus from Udinese is edging somewhat closer to completion after his agent confirmed that the clubs are continuing to discuss a deal.

The English media are also today reporting that the Turin giants have resurrected their interest in Arsenal’s Robin van Persie by offering the London club £20m for the player and giving him a five-year deal worth £190,000 per week.

Rubin Kazan defender Salvatore Bocchetti has also hinted that he wants a return to the peninsula with the reigning league champions who are looking to bring in a new central defender.

The Bianconeri are also refusing to give up in their pursuit of Sampdoria midfielder Andrea Poli and after their initial bid of €7m was rejected and could offer Ouasim Bouy as part of the deal who Juve brought in from Ajax.

Another player who could be leaving Antonio Conte’s club is 20-year-old midfielder Manuel Giandonato who is wanted by a slew of Serie B club including Novara, Vicenza and Brescia.

Milan are refusing to give up on their attempts to sign Montpellier Mapou Yanga-Mbiwa and Adriano Galliani will fly to France tomorrow in an attempt to sign the French defender but they will have to increase their bid from the initial €6m which was turned down.

However, Silvio Berlusconi has today revealed that the club are no closer to bringing Kaka back to San Siro.

Didac Vila has returned to Spain after just six months as Valencia have agreed a deal with Milan to bring the player in on an initial loan deal with the option to purchase for €3.5m while Taye Taiwo has also confirmed his loan switch to Dynamo Kiev.

With Lucas Moura still mulling over the opportunity to sign for Inter this summer, they are lining up two Bundesliga stars should he decide not to join them.

Both Bayern Munich’s Thomas Muller and Borussia Dortmund’s Mario Gotze are being monitored by the Nerazzurri as potential arrivals.

Both Milan clubs are set to battle it out against each other to secure the signing of out-of-favour Napoli midfielder Andrea Dossena although the Partenopei rejected the Rossoneri’s offer to bring him in on initial loan deal as they would prefer to sell the player.

One of Inter’s brightest young stars Samuele Longo is wanted by Real Madrid according to reports circulating today.

In a surprising turn of events in the future of Alberto Gilardino have now seen him linked with a move to Torino despite being linked with moves to Russia, France and even Inter.

Roma have moved ahead of Napoli and into pole position to sign Palermo left back Federico Balzaretti after increasing their offer for the Italian international.

After Lazio and Napoli’s attempts to bring in Atalanta defender Federico Peluso failed, Juventus and Palermo have now also joined the race to bring him in.

As reported here yesterday, Torino have indeed parted company with Damiano Ferronetti despite the player being signed 10 days ago on a two-year deal and no reason has yet been given from either party for the decision.

Sporting star and ex-Serie A frontman Valeri Bojinov could be in line for a return to Italy with Chievo Verona looking to further strengthen their attack.

Udinese are in need of signing a new goalkeeper after the departure of Samir Handanovic to Inter and he could be replaced by free agent Alex Manninger.

Finally, Lazio defender Guglielmo Stendardo is close to leaving the club to join Atalanta on a three-year deal.
